There’s no comparison at all as far as functions/features. The Olight is way better. I’ve bought a half-dozen different lights from them in the last two months. Some for me, and some for Christmas gifts.

If I was going to buy another one for EDC, I’d go with the bigger Baton Pro instead of the Mini Baton. The Mini is just a little awkward to handle due to short length. The Pro is what I bought my dad. They have a wide range of modes from a 0.5 lumen moonlight (that last 20 days) to a Turbo that will melt your face.

If you’re going to place an order, add at least one I1R light to your cart. Or if you prefer AAA over rechargeable, the slightly bigger I3E. Either one fits on a key ring.

I also have a I3T that’s real similar to the Streamlight Microstream.

Just thinking about the Microstream and Stylus Pro I have, I do like the tail switch better than the side switch on the Olight Mini Baton. The Streamlights are also a basic off/on function, while you have to actually read the manual on the Olight. Clicks, double clicks, triple clicks, hold for 1 second, etc...all to access different modes.
 
I have a Olight S1R for a few years. It survives at least three washer and dryer cycles. The battery got trashed with the heat and no longer takes a charge. A new battery and the light is still kicking.

I use Olights most days. I have an S1a that's magnetically attached to my bedside reading lamp for the trips to the bathroom in the night. I use an H2r headlamp around the yard almost nightly. I have a bunch. Most have been very reliable with a few older models being a bit finicky with switches.

I carried the S1 mini for a couple of years in the bottom of my pocket everyday. It looks like junk but still works fine.
